What is the Rajpura Master Plan 2031?

The plan has been launched by GMADA and PUDA.

A giant leap for the infrastructure development of the region, Rajpura Master Plan 2031 aims to promote sustainable land use patterns for various purposes. This plan has been launched by Greater Mohali Area Development Authority (GMADA) and Punjab Urban Planning and Development Authority (PUDA) for infrastructural growth in the region. Among the main aims of this plan are extensively planned upgrades for land use patterns for infrastructure projects and affordable housing and transportation for the residents of the region. Key features

Rajpura Master Plan 2031 aims for the development of a vast range of sectors, ranging from industries, trade and commerce to residential and commercial land use. Here are the main proposals of the plan:

  • To enhance the region’s connectivity with roadways between Rajpura and the state capital Chandigarh, a rail link between Rajpura and Mohali has been proposed.
  • For smooth functioning of retail and wholesale activities, land for residential, industrial and commercial purposes will be especially designated.
  • Plans for construction of new roadways infrastructure, including elevated roads, flyovers, rail over bridges, and pedestrian underpasses and overbridges, are in the pipeline to ensure easy commute.
  • Social infrastructure and amenities for education, healthcare and recreation will be developed to serve the needs of the residents.

 

Proposed land allocation

The land use proposed for the various development projects under Rajpura Master Plan 2031 has been drafted and approved. Following are the details:

 

Zone Definition Urbanisable limit %
Residential Zone designated for people to live in 62.06
Commercial Area specially for shops, businesses and related activities 0.13
Industrial zone Areas that will house factories, manufacturing plants and industrial estates 17.01
Wholesale warehousing zone Areas for wholesale trading and storage facilities 3.79
Mix zone Zones that allow multiple activities and serve a range of purposes 8.89

Source: Greater Mohali Area Development Authority (GMADA)
